Output 77dd8d8249a2a4108cbbb23ae71fe02660189c0403dc0188805581a8297fb695:2

value
252631608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9fab2d40767a61d47a43b8659ce47184ab3a1cb OP_EQUAL
address
MWgvp34puVY1GKuSUTvE4917fqdEfTmdUS
transaction
77dd8d8249a2a4108cbbb23ae71fe02660189c0403dc0188805581a8297fb695
spent
true